Web16 okt. 2024 · Except for 「し」、「ち」、「つ」、and 「ん」、you can get a sense of how each letter is pronounced by matching the consonant on the top row to the vowel. For example, 「き」 would become / ki / and 「ゆ」 would become / yu / and so on. As you can see, not all sounds match the way our consonant system works. Web6 feb. 2024 · There are 3 basic writing systems you need to learn to be able to read Japanese: Hiragana, Katakana, and Kanji. Hiragana The ability to read Hiragana is crucial for all beginners. Hiragana is primarily used for native Japanese words and consists of 46 characters or 51 phonetic characters.

WebThere are four ways to translate names into Japanese: 1. Phonetic Translation – katakana 2. Phonetic Translation – hiragana 3. Phonetic Translation – kanji 4. Literal Translation – kanji For the phonetic translations, the pronunciation of the name is used to translate the name – not the spelling. Kanji (かんじ 漢字) is the Japanese writing system that originated from the Chinese Hanzi characters. Kanji characters have the widest variety among the three Japanese alphabets.
